Experts and historians say that the spread of French in Algeria is due to its imposition during the 132-year colonial era (1830-1962) and the struggle against the occupation for the Arabic language, as well as the delay in the application of laws for Arabization of administration and education after independence. short term debt asset or liability

WebAlgeria has two official languages, the first being Arabic, which has been recognized as the country’s official language since 1963 and the other Berber, which has had national language status since 2016. These two languages are the native tongue of over 99% of the population of Algeria. Tying into the countries Colonial history, French is ...
